2. Schools of Sanatana Dharma -

Our religion has more than 33 crore devtas, crores and crores of Chamunda, Shakti, das mahavidyas, Sri Vidya, Brahma ,Vishnu, Rudra, Maheshwara, Sadashiva,  Saraswati, Lakshmi, Gauri, Durga, kali,etc. and the list is endless.

Our religion has various schools. here the word school means sampradaya.
They are as follows and each sampradaya is greater than the previous one in ascending order:
A)Vedic Sampradaya - Thi is a class of Santana Dharmi who beleive in Vedic paddhati and follow all vedic rules and regulations. The only chant vedic mantras and sukt. They primarily worship Lord Agni,Vayu,Aakash, Prithvi, Varuna,Indra and Gayatri Maa. Their worship rituals are purely satvik.
B) Vaishnava - Vedic mantras and rituals even though long but are unbelievably powerful. But even greater than Vedachar or vedic sampradaya is Vaishnavaachar. The vaishnavas only worship Lord Vishnu or his dashavataras. The mantras are usually rajasic though many consider their mantras to be satvik. By worshipping Lord Vishnu, a person goes to vaikunth.
C) Shaiv Sampradaya - Even greater than Vashanvachar is Shaivachar. This is a class of Sanatana Dharmi who believe in Lord Shiva. They believe that Lord Shiva is the supreme and they only and only worship Lord Shiva and chant only Lord Shiv's mantra.
D) Sauraachar - This class of people worship Lord Surya. The only chant surya mantras and worship Lord Surya alone. This school is on par with Shiavachar even though Surya dev in a form of Narayan.

E) Gaanapatya Samradaya - This school worships Lord Ganapati alone and chant only Lord Ganesh's mantras. This achar/school is as great as Shaivachar.

F) Smarta - This is the school of people who worship multiple Gods at once. However, Ganesh, Shiv, Narayan, Durga, Surya are their main deities. This achar is as great as Vaishanaachar.

G) Shaakt Sampradaya - Even greater than Shaivachar is Shaaktaachar. This school worships the shaktis or the female goddesses.

H) Dakshinachar - This is tantrik school whose worship and mantra sadhanas are tantrik in nature. The involve more of puja or tantra than mantras. It is greater than Shaivachar. However, it is a school of Shiv bhakts only. The difference between Shaiv and Dakshinachar is that Shaivachar is only and only of worshipping Lord Shiv. No one else. Kundalini also comes under Dakshinachar.

I) Vaamachar - Greater than dakshinachar is Vamachar, which is another school of Lord Shiva. Vamachar is almost all about tantra and tantrik prayogas. Hardly does it involve use of mantras or stotras. It may seem very cruel for those who are still at the materialistic level of spirituality. However, this is not true. Vamachar is very powerful. It is very secretive and and only revealed in front of the deserving ones.

J) Siddhantaachaar - This achar is also of Lord Shiva. This achar focuses on yogas, mudras, yogaasan and kundalini jagran. It is the third greatest school.

K) Shri Vidya - For a grihasth, vaishanvachar is very beneficial. Shaivachar is 1000 times more beneficial than Vaishanavachaar. But the Shri Vidya upasana or sampradaya is 1 crore times more beneficial than Shaivaachar. Only those who goddess Lalita herself wants, can worship her, no one else.

L) Kaulachar - The greatest and the most secretive  aachaar in the entire brahmand. The school of Lord Shiva that is unknown even to Lord Shiva's own son Ganesha. Then what can be said about Brahma and Vishnu?
This aachar focuses on worshipping the kul devta and kuleshwari. Other than this, the school involves worship of Kundalini, Mahavidyas, Shiv-Shakti,etc.



3. Bhaav - 
There are 3 types of bhaav or emotional state under which we perform a mantra sadhana -
A) Daas bhaav(subordinate bhaav) - In this bhaav, we worship gods as being under his servants. The vedachar and vaishnavachaar is followed under daas bhaav only.
This bhaav teaches us, the significance of love and affection. As a vedachari and a vaishnav, we learn that love, affection and care has the ability to make even stone turn into honey. It is teaches us that we spread love and treat everyone and everything around us as an embodiment of god. This bhaav teaches us bhakti.

B) Veer Bhaav - Being extremely disciplined in life and allowing even cruelty on yourself for the sake of dharma is what veer bhaav teaches us. Being cruel for the protection of dharma, being powerful and extremely courageous, but being extremely generous at the same time are the qualities of a veer purush. Such a person never fears anything in life, for he knows that god is always there and there is nothing that can stop him for achieving the impossible. Such a person is the dear one of Lord Rudra. All the sampradaya except Vaishanavachar and Vedachaar promote Veer bhaav.
This bhaav is mainly for people whose life is all about dharma-karma. This bhaav is not meant for a grihasth ashram.

C) Pashu bhava - The word pashu means "emotional". Pashu bhaav means people who are excessively emotional and attached in life. Such people always experience some or the other kind of sorrow in life due to their emotional nature. The best example of being emotional nature is of a dog. If you observe a dog, you will find that a dog always has some or the other kind of emotional state going on. That is why, in sanatana dharma, getting moksha is most difficult for a dog.
The person who maintains such a bhaav remains a failure not only in spirituality sector but also in the worldly life sector. By chanting the name of Shri Rama, a sadhak can get rid of pashu bhaav.

There is very nice incident, which relates with this same behaviour.
Once there was a man who tired of chanting the same old mantras which every one else was chanting around him. He was given the diksha of Gayatri Maa. He would see that everyone around him also chants the same mantra as he would.
He became very irritated as to why my guru is giving me the mantra which is already known to so many people.
Whenever the sadhak would have problem in life, the sadhak would go to his guru and the guru would tell him to chant the same mantra i.e. gayatri Mantra every time.
Soon, he became very irritated and annoyed of this behaviour of his guru.
One day, his irritation reached its peak and he went to his guru in extreme anger.
He told his guru that he was tired of chanting the same mantras again and again and he wanted to get a mantra which is the rarest of the rarest and not known to any other person in the world before.
His guru, having understood his ignorance, very smartly gave him diksha of Shri Rama Jay Rama mantra and told him to chant this mantra while sitting in a river.
The sadhak became very happy that finally he has got the rarest of the rarest mantra and a mantra which was not known to any one before and now, he will be greatest among all the people on earth.
The sadhak took the blessings of his guru and went to the river and started chanting the mantra.
He started chanting the mantra at night and kept on chanting it whole night long. He kept on chanting it for nights and nights.  He kept on chanting that mantra on and on and very soon, he also got the sakshatkar of Lord Rama.
After getting sakshatkar of Lord Rama, the sadhak would still come every night and chant that mantra for the whole night.
One night, the sadhak got so deeply engrossed in the japa that he didn't even realise when the night ended and the sun rose up.
As the sun rose up, the sadhak could feel rays of sun falling on him and then he opened his eyes.
On coming out of the meditative state, the sadhak saw a Shri Rama temple nearby where there hoards of people.
And as soon as the sadhak went inside the temple to salute to the god, he saw that every single person in that temple was chanting the same mantra which his guru had given him.
The sadhak got furious and started cursing his guru. He started saying that his guru  is a fool. He had asked for the rarest and the most unknown mantra and his guru gave him a mantra which was known to every one.

Boiling with anger and also sad with this kind of behaviour of his guru, he went back to his him and asked him:
 O! my Omnipresent and all-knowing gurudev, what was my fault that you have decieted me in such a way. I had asked you to give me the most unknown mantra. A mantra which has not been given to any one before. But you! you gave a mantra which is known to each and every person around me.


Guru dev said:
Son I have never decieted you. Everyone around you knows this mantra. Everyone around you may have chanted this more times in their lifetime than you have. But is only you my son who knows the power of this mantra and it is only you who has got the sakshatkar of Lord Rama.

Remember son, that the power of a mantra isn't decided by how rare a mantra is or how unknown it is, but it is decided by how much faith you have in the mantra. It is only you who knew the power of the mantra out of the thousands of people out there and it is only because of this, that you got the sakshatkar of Shri Rama.
Mantras can be shared by anyone and from any where, but its real power is only understood by the gyaani  and the true bhakt.
If you don't have gyaan and most importantly bhakti, mantras like Shri Rama Jay Rama will always remain a simple mantra for you.
